Mīrāth calculates the distribution of an estate according to Islamic inheritance law (al-farāiḍ) and — above all — explains why each heir receives their share.
Built for people who don't know fiqh, the app guides you through a series of simple questions to reconstruct the family, then shows a clear, justified result.
WHAT MAKES MĪRĀTH DIFFERENT
• A guided, question-by-question assistant: no empty form — the app builds the family with you.
• A justification for every share: "the daughter receives ½ because she is alone, with no son and no father."
• Two savable viewpoints: "What I leave as inheritance" and "What I inherit."
• A visual family tree, with blocked heirs (ḥajb) shown and explained.
• Exact fraction arithmetic (no rounding) for full religious fidelity.
CASES COVERED
Spouse(s), parents and grandparents, sons and daughters, grandchildren, siblings (full, paternal, maternal), including awl, radd, umariyyatān, the grandfather's muqāsama, al-Akdariyya and the al-mushtaraka case (with differing opinions noted).
